Conergy Plans To Cancel Solar Wafer Supply Contracts With MEMC

Conergy AG (Conergy), a Germany-based supplier of solar and other renewable energies, is discussing with MEMC Electronic Materials, Inc. (MEMC) to renegotiate its long-term solar wafer supply contracts worth around $4 billion over a ten-year period, since beginning of 2009. An agreement has yet to be reached, resulting in Conergy warning that it might begin legal proceedings to terminate the contracts.
Conergy also said that the drop in polysilicon prices had turned the market from a seller's to a buyer’s and that legal doubts had emerged over the posibility of some contractual provisions of the contract, without specifying what these provisions may be. As a result, the contracts could be worthless.
Conergy plans a new one-year deal struck with MEMC in the next few days, otherwise legal action will start.
Conergy said it had already written down the prepayments made to MEMC in its annual accounts. Conergy could anticipate high one-time costs, but it would ‘open up new options for the future.’
“Conergy’s profitability comes first for us,” said Dieter Ammer, chief executive officer of Conergy. “The contract with MEMC signed by the previous management board does not reflect in any way the very strong decline in market prices for wafers. In addition, we have strong doubts about the legal structure of the contract. We would be prepared to accept the high costs of cancelling the contract because, on the one hand, they are not cash-effective and, on the other hand, they would improve Conergy’s profitability on a sustainable basis onwards. Of course, we would prefer an amicable solution.”
